West Side Motorcycle Wreck Kills Man

CHICAGO (STMW) - A man riding a Suzuki motorcycle was killed early Saturday when he crashed on the West Side.

About 1 a.m. the 32-year-old man was southbound on Cicero and had just passed Le Moyne Street when he rear-ended a car traveling in front of him, according to a Grand Central District police lieutenant.

The collision sent him flying across the street where he hit a another vehicle and careened off it into a third vehicle, sending the motorcycle back into the southbound lanes, according to the lieutenant.

The victim fell off the Suzuki motorcycle, which had no passengers, and was killed, the lieutenant said.

The victim's name was not being released pending notification of family members, but he was pronounced dead at 3:16 a.m. at Mount Sinai Hospital, according to a spokesman for the Cook County Medical Examiner's office.

It was not known how fast the man was traveling, or whether drugs or alcohol were factors.

The police Major Accident Investigation Unit is looking into the wreck.
